Bishopbriggs Pass Rate Statistics

Pass Rate Comparison

CategoryBishopbriggsNational AverageDifference
Overall50.5%51.8%-1.3%
Male49.2%51.8%-2.6%
Female52.1%51.8%+0.3%
First Attempt53.8%51.8%+2.0%
Automatic41.1%51.8%-10.7%

Difficulty Analysis

At 50.5%, the pass rate at Bishopbriggs is effectively in line with the national average of 51.8%, sitting squarely in the middle of the difficulty spectrum at rank 163 of 322. Pass rates have improved modestly over recent years, moving from 45.5% to 50.5%, a gradual gain of 5.0 percentage points. Younger candidates at 17 perform notably well here with a 70.9% pass rate, compared to an average of 49.5% for those aged 22-25.

How to Pass Your Driving Test at Bishopbriggs

Expert Tips

  1. 1

    Practise driving on roads where visibility is limited by terrain, adjusting your speed accordingly.

  2. 2

    Practise clutch control at low speed, essential for the tight turns and gradients common around Scottish test centres.

  3. 3

    Build confidence with overtaking slower vehicles safely on single-carriageway A-roads.

  4. 4

    Get comfortable with mini-roundabouts, common in suburban areas and testing your observation and timing.

  5. 5

    Work on smooth transitions between 20, 30, and 40 mph zones, as speed changes are frequent in suburban areas.

  6. 6

    If taking the test in an automatic at Bishopbriggs, be aware the automatic pass rate is 41.1%, notably lower than the 50.5% overall. Extra practice around the centre is advisable.

Frequently Asked Questions About Bishopbriggs

What is the pass rate at Bishopbriggs?+

The current pass rate at Bishopbriggs is 50.5%. The national average is 51.8%. These figures are based on 5,661 tests conducted during April 2024 - March 2025. The male pass rate is 49.2% and the female pass rate is 52.1%.

Is Bishopbriggs a hard driving test centre?+

Bishopbriggs is ranked 163 out of 322 UK test centres for difficulty and is classified as "Average". The pass rate is below the national average, which may indicate a more challenging test experience.
